Guys, anyone knows if the problem with reddit's dogetipbot was fixed? People were talking about a decentralized control of the dogetipbot, which seems a great idea if it can be implemented.
Problem won't be fixed because people lost their money, if it gets fixed will take hell a lot of the time since there were millions of dogecoins involved right there. There wasn't any problem with a bot, it worked fine but bot owner used the funds and sold them. Currently new bot is being developed that will send transactions through block-chain not an offchain transaction. I don't know many details but I don't know how are they going t make it decentralized, would be cool if they do tho. Currently because there is no bots they have made a simple address book, where users type their address and when somebody wants to tip he asks bot for users address, can check this post : https://www.reddit.com/r/dogecoin/comments/6bkih7/bot_help_for_onchain_giveaway/Thank you, I'll check it out.
